1. [停搏]:讨论 心脏第一级起搏点在一定时间内不能形成并发放冲动称窦性停搏(arrest)或窦性静止(standstill). 停搏时间往往与窦性周期不成倍数,长间歇后一般出现逸搏. 病态窦房结综合征为*常见原因. 心肌梗死、急性心肌炎、急性心包炎及洋地黄、奎尼丁、心律平、β

    词语用法

    词义讲解

    词源解说

    v.(动词)

    arrest用作动词的基本意思是指根据法律或命令进行逮捕并予以监禁或拘留,引申可指中途制止某种行动。用于比喻,可指吸引。

    arrest是及物动词,接名词或代词作宾语,与介词for搭配可表示被捕的原因,可用于被动结构。

    arrest作“引起,吸引”解时,一般与attention等词搭配使用,且多用于主动语态。

    arrest是非延续性动词,不可与表示一段时间的状语连用。

    v.(动词)

    arrest, apprehend, attach, detain

    这组词都有依法逮捕、拘押、监禁的意思,其区别是:

    arrest可用于刑事案件,也可用于民事案件,如债务等; 而apprehend只用于刑事案件; attach常指因逃脱而扣押或查封,用于人时也只指将其拘留到法庭出庭作证; detain则是为了询问或审查而拘留或监护,不是严格的法律术语。

    ☆ 14世纪晚期进入英语,直接源自古法语的arester,意为保持,停留;*初源自通俗拉丁语的arrestare:ad (去) + restare (停止,保留),意为淹留在后。
